S is for SPLIT. Income splitting is a strategy that involves transferring a portion of income from someone who's in a high tax bracket to a person who is within a lower tax group. It may even be possible to reduce the tax on the transferred income to zero if this person, doesn't have any other taxable income. Normally, the other individual is either your spouse or common-law spouse, but it could even be your children. Whenever it is possible to transfer income to a person in a lower tax bracket, it should be done. If profitable between tax rates is 20% your family will save $200 for every $1,000 transferred towards the "lower rate" general.
